Today on the show, we're talking about the Lions, Michigan and Michigan State athletics, the NCAA Tournament, and more as we were joined by some of our great guests. We kicked off the show talking with Jim Comparoni from SpartanMag.com about Spartan hoops. He and Huge talked about Selection Sunday and gave their initial thoughts on if MSU would even have their name called. They also looked ahead to Thursday's game against Mississippi State, talked about how the two teams stack up, and more. Chris Balas from theWolverine.com joined us in our second hour to talk about Michigan basketball and football. He and Huge talked about the end of the Juwan Howard era and gave their thoughts on what the future could look like as far as getting a new Head Coach goes. Chris also updated us on Sherrone Moore's staff, talked about Spring ball which started today, and much more. We were then joined by Tim Staudt from Staudt on Sports in Lansing to talk some more Spartan basketball. Tim gave us his thoughts on how Izzo and his team will do in the Tournament, gave his opinion on how some of the other teams will do, and more. We were joined by Kyle Austin from MLive in our final hour to talk more about the Spartans and the NCAA Tournament. Kyle told us what was going through his head last night before MSU had their name called, gave his thoughts on how the Spartans will do in the Tournament, and more. We were then joined by CBS Bracketologist Jerry Palm to talk about selection Sunday and the Tournament. He told us what surprised him the most yesterday, gave his thoughts on who the best teams are going to be in the Tournament, and much more. We wrapped up the show with a "Moving Ferris Forward" interview as Huge spoke with FSU Head Men's Basketball Coach Andy Bronkema. He talked with us about his team going in the DII Tournament, talked about going to the Sweet 16, and more.
